Installation of Lifts

The Installation of Lifts Scheme offers owners/tenants residing in social accommodation the opportunity to apply for the installation of a lift in government-owned dwellings.

Owners should have purchased their property under one of the Schemes where the Government encouraged tenants to become homeowners.

The Housing Authority aims to improve accessibility by installing lifts where possible, enabling residents to continue living in their current homes.

Properties that qualify under this scheme must either be fully owned by the government or co-owned with residents who purchased their homes from the Authority or third parties. Additionally, at least one of the applicants must have a disability or severe mobility issues.
